Bernard d'Agesci
Bernard d'Agesci was a French painter and copyist (1757–1828). He was born at Niort.
Also recorded as Augustin Bernard; Bernard d'Agescy; Bernard d' Agesci; Bernard d' Agescy.
Recognition and collections
Work by Bernard d'Agesci is held by Philadelphia Museum of Art, Art Institute of Chicago, Berkeley Art Museum and Pacific Film Archive and Musée Bernard d'Agesci.
